There are many reasons to seek the advice of an experienced family law attorney. An attorney will inform you of your rights and responsibilities and provide you with an array of legal options and the steps you can take to prepare yourself for a divorce, a prenuptial agreement, or other domestic issue. Just a few of the reasons to contact a family law attorney are:
- The law is constantly changing and you need a professional who can advise you on the current state of the law.
- Judges have a lot of discretion in family law cases; an attorney is more informed of the strategies and information that help persuade a judge to rule in your favor.
- There are often ”exceptions to the rules” and you need an experienced family law attorney to guide you through the process.
Knowledge is power, and if you have a grasp of both the practical and legal aspects of your situation, you can make confident and informed decisions on these important matters.
